一:需求分析 输入一组数字要求倒序输出,例如输入为123输出是321(ipo图)
二:设计(流程图)
三:编码
#include "stdio.h"
/*
* 功 能: 输入一组数字要求倒序输出
* 开发日期: 2006年11月8日
* 开发小组: 蜗牛工作室
* 版 本: V.10
*/
void main()
{
/*定义变量a接收用户键盘输入,b包村中间结果*/
int a=0,b=0;
/*定义变量c保存倒序的输出*/
long c=0;
printf("input is nubmer:/n");
scanf("%d",&a);
/*用循来取出每一位数,用c按位保存*/
do
{
b=a%10;
a=a/10;
c=c*10+b;
}while(a>0)
/*循环结束,输出*/
printf("output end=%ld/n",c);
}
四:测试
五:维护
二:设计(流程图)
三:编码
#include "stdio.h"
/*
* 功 能: 输入一组数字要求倒序输出
* 开发日期: 2006年11月8日
* 开发小组: 蜗牛工作室
* 版 本: V.10
*/
void main()
{
/*定义变量a接收用户键盘输入,b包村中间结果*/
int a=0,b=0;
/*定义变量c保存倒序的输出*/
long c=0;
printf("input is nubmer:/n");
scanf("%d",&a);
/*用循来取出每一位数,用c按位保存*/
do
{
b=a%10;
a=a/10;
c=c*10+b;
}while(a>0)
/*循环结束,输出*/
printf("output end=%ld/n",c);
}
四:测试
五:维护